空气质量专题地图系统开发与应用

版权申诉
0 下载量 81 浏览量 更新于2024-10-12 收藏 39.71MB ZIP 举报
资源摘要信息:"毕业设计-空气质量专题地图系统.zip" 从标题和描述来看,该资源是一个与空气质量监测和分析相关的专题地图系统。该系统可能是面向毕业设计项目的,专注于空气质量数据的可视化和空间分析。虽然未提供具体标签,但通过文件名可推测系统可能与地理信息系统(GIS)、环境科学、数据可视化、Web开发和数据库管理等相关领域紧密相连。 知识点一:空气质量监测与分析 1. 空气质量指数(AQI)的定义与计算方法,如何评价空气质量。 2. 空气污染物的种类,包括但不限于PM2.5、PM10、SO2、NO2等。 3. 空气污染源分析,包括自然源和人为源。 4. 空气质量监测站点的布局与数据采集方法。 5. 时间序列分析,分析空气质量变化趋势。 知识点二:专题地图系统设计与开发 1. GIS(地理信息系统)的基本概念及其在空气质量地图系统中的应用。 2. 地图数据的存储格式,如Shapefile、GeoJSON、KML等。 3. 地图服务的构建方法,如WMS(Web Map Service)、WFS(Web Feature Service)。 4. 地图交互设计,包括缩放、拖动、图层控制等用户界面元素。 5. 响应式设计,确保地图系统能够在不同尺寸的设备上良好运行。 知识点三:数据可视化技术 1. 常见的可视化图表类型,例如散点图、折线图、热力图、饼图等。 2. 高级数据可视化技术,例如基于地图的动态热力图。 3. 可视化设计原则,如何制作清晰、直观且美观的图表。 4. 前端可视化技术,如D3.js、Highcharts等库的应用。 5. 数据挖掘和分析在空气质量专题地图系统中的应用。 知识点四:Web开发技术 1. 前端开发技术栈,包括HTML、CSS、JavaScript及其框架(如React.js、Vue.js等)。 2. 后端开发技术,如Node.js、Python Flask/Django等。 3. 数据库技术,如MySQL、PostgreSQL、MongoDB等。 4. API设计与开发,提供数据接口给前端进行展示。 5. 用户界面设计原则,提升用户体验。 知识点五:数据库管理与查询优化 1. SQL(结构化查询语言)基本操作,包括数据的增删改查。 2. 数据库索引的使用,提升查询效率。 3. 数据库规范化,保证数据的一致性。 4. 大数据量处理技术,确保系统的稳定性和响应速度。 5. 数据库备份与恢复策略,防止数据丢失。 综上所述,该毕业设计项目涉及到了环境科学、地理信息系统、数据可视化、前端与后端Web开发以及数据库管理等多个领域。对于设计者来说,必须具备跨学科的知识和技能,以便构建出既能够准确展示空气质量数据,又能提供良好用户体验的专题地图系统。在实际操作中,设计者需要深入分析空气质量数据,采用合适的可视化技术展现数据变化,同时保证系统的高性能和稳定性,以实现数据的高效管理和可视化展示。